NORWOOD
Norwood’s versatility has received a boost with Matt Panos and Ed Smart returning to face South on Friday night.
The flexible utilities have recovered from minor injuries to be named across the half-forward line to confront the Panthers.
The premiership pair have been joined in the Redlegs’ 23-man squad by Harrison Viney, who has been named on the extended interchange bench.
Clever goalsneak Simon Phillips is the only certain exclusion at this stage due to a work commitment.

SOUTH
South Adelaide could unleash two mature-age debutants against Norwood at The Parade on Friday night.
Alex Moyle (22, 173cm and 76kg) from Reynella and Matt Raitt (22, 178cm and 76kg) from Flagstaff Hill have been named in the Panthers’ 23-man squad, together with fellow inclusion Xavier Gotch, who has been named in the midfield.
Dual Mail Medallist Rigby Barnes is the only certain exclusion at this stage due to a groin complaint, with two more to be trimmed before the bounce.
Former Magpie Ben Haren will play his 50th SANFL Macca’s League match.

ADELAIDE
Adelaide has included five players for its SANFL Showdown against Port at Maughan Thiem Hyundai Oval on Saturday.
AFL-listed trio Harrison Wigg, Tom Doedee and Jordan Gallucci all return, with the latter pair overcoming minor injuries.
Development players Tyson Lever and Mitchell Minns have been named on the five-man extended interchange bench.
Ruckman Reilly O’Brien has been called up to the AFL squad along with first-year player Myles Poholke while Kurt Waterman was squeezed out of the 23-man squad.

PORT
Port Adelaide captain Steven Summerton could be the only SANFL-contracted player to line up for the Magpies in Saturday’s SANFL Showdown at Maughan Thiem Hyundai Oval.
The injection of four AFL-listed players – Matt Lobbe, Angus Monfries, Nathan Krakouer and Cam Hewett – has forced the omission of Luke Reynolds while Jesse Palmer has been called up by Power coach Ken Hinkley.
This will leave skipper Summerton, named on the five-man extended interchange bench, as the sole non AFL-listed player to tackle the Crows from 1.10pm.

GLENELG
Highly-rated teenager Darcy Fogarty could play his first SANFL Macca’s League match for Glenelg against Central on Saturday.
Previously engaged with the AFL Academy, Fogarty (17, 192cm and 88kg) is itching to play senior football for the Tigers ahead of this year’s AFL U18 National Championships.
The talented utility has been named on the extended interchange bench for the Bays, together with key defender Max Proud and strongly-built midfielder Elliot Chalmers.
Small defender Harley Montgomery has been sent back to the Reserves.
2016 Glenelg Best and Fairest Josh Scott will play his 50th SANFL Macca’s League match.

NORTH
The long wait for Ben Darrou to make his SANFL Macca’s League debut is almost over.
After playing just 16 Reserves games for South Adelaide in the past two years due to injury, the North Adelaide key defender is set to play his first League match for the Roosters against West on Saturday.
The former Richmond rookie (23, 191cm and 96kg) joined North during summer seeking a fresh start and now has his opportunity after being named at full back by coach Josh Carr.
He has been joined in the Roosters’ 23-man squad by Blake Helyar, who has been named on the five-man extended interchange bench.

WEST
West Adelaide will be without star recruit Jake Wilson for at least a month after he was sidelined by injury in Round 3.
A member of last year’s VFL Team of the Year, Wilson hurt his knee against Norwood last Friday night.
The key defender will be joined by John Noble on the out list, with the latter sent back to the Reserves.
Speedy pair Murray Waite and Izak Rankine have been named on the extended interchange bench to possibly play their first Macca’s League game of the year.
They have been joined in the 23-man squad by key position duo Ben Klemke and Jesse Watchman, with Klemke likely to fill Wilson’s role.
